Resumen
[EN] Academic rankings provide an opportunity to increase visibility and reputation of institutions and can be used as benchmark tools for quality improvement, despite much criticism of biased coverage and flawed methodologies. As part of the University of Lisbon, Técnico Lisboa – a leading Portuguese engineering and technology school – has monitored and examined rankings through its Rankings Observatory in the context of strategic options, but institutional transformations have been an obstacle to exactly measure Técnico’s worth or weight in the context of the University of Lisbon. Those transformations have not contributed to leverage the positioning of the University of Lisbon in major rankings either. This paper discusses the impact of institutional transformations on the University of Lisbon and Técnico in rankings, describes attempts made by Técnico to overcome these constraints and gives examples of how Técnico applies rankings as internal benchmark tools towards continuous improvement.
